o Deva allows you to keep your recorded audio on the set, allowing production to instantly reference
previous recordings. Disputes with post regarding recording issues can be immediately cleared up and
extra copies of recorded audio can be produced in case of lost, damaged or stolen material.
o Output 4 types of AES-31 Broadcast Wave files to post.
o Deva offers direct Avid and Pro-Tools compatibility. This saves a tremendous amount of time loading
files in post production.
o Scene, Take, Note and Roll Number Metadata can be entered into the Deva using the touch screen
display, Mix-12/Cameo mixer or external keyboard. This data goes directly into the Avid post
production system. All metadata can be easily edited on the Deva to assure post gets the correct
information for each take.
o The Deva supports the FAt-32 disk format, so DVD-RAM disks and FireWire hard drives created by
the Deva are directly readable on both Macintosh and Windows computers without using third-party
software drivers.
Hints on Using Your Deva
The Deva uses a high resolution PDA-style touch screen to access software functions. In most cases you
can use your finger to make selections, however, you may also any brand of PDA stylus.
There are two ways to navigate from menu to menu. One is to push the menu button on the front panel.
The other is to touch the status display in any screen. The status display, in the upper right corner of the
touch screen, shows whether Deva is in stop, play or record mode.
Note: Touching the status button or pushing the menu button does not change the mode the Deva is currently using. It is
safe to make either selection while recording.
Throughout this manual the following conventions are used:
o Toggle is used when the selection rotates through a number of possible selections. For example, File
Resolution toggles between 16 Bits and 24 Bits.
